SpaceX's Ambitious Vision: Building Businesses Beyond Earth

SpaceX's Galactic Goals

In the ever-evolving landscape of aerospace innovation, SpaceX is leading the charge with a daring proposition: establishing a network of businesses on the Moon, Mars, and potentially beyond. This vision, as ambitious as it is groundbreaking, reflects a paradigm shift in how humanity perceives its role in the cosmos.

The Moon as a Business Hub

Imagine a thriving marketplace on the Moon, where companies trade, mine resources, and conduct research. Such concepts, once relegated to the realm of science fiction, are now being taken seriously by industry experts and space enthusiasts alike.

“The Moon could serve not just as a launchpad for interplanetary missions but also as a site for ongoing human activity,” notes Dr. Jane Holloway, a noted astrobiologist.

Mars: The Next Frontier

Following the lunar ambitions, Mars stands as the next frontier. With its unique environment and resources, the Red Planet presents a myriad of opportunities. SpaceX's plans for Mars are not solely for colonization; they aim to create a sustainable economic model.

  • Infrastructure development for habitation.
  • Leveraging Martian minerals for trade.
  • Scientific research with commercial applications.

The Role of Technology

Central to these plans is the development of advanced technologies that can facilitate life and work on extraterrestrial bodies. From reusable rockets to life support systems, SpaceX's innovations could redefine not only lunar and Martian operations but also terrestrial applications, fostering a new era of technological interconnectedness.

Financial Implications

Launching such ambitious endeavors will require significant investment, both public and private. SpaceX's approach may open the floodgates for investment in space commerce, highlighting how public interests align with corporate goals in a burgeoning industry.

Challenges Ahead

However, SpaceX's vision is not without hurdles:

  1. Regulatory Hurdles: Legal frameworks governing activities beyond Earth are still in their infancy.
  2. Ethical Considerations: As we venture into new territories, questions about the ethical implications of colonizing other planets arise.
  3. Technical Feasibility: The challenges of sustaining human life and running businesses far from Earth must be addressed thoroughly.

Community Impact

The ripple effects of SpaceX's efforts will reach back to Earth. Local economies may benefit from technology transfers, job creation, and educational opportunities. Space exploration initiatives tend to inspire interest in STEM fields, which could drive a new generation of innovators.
